Output 437856677d723fbb7eb82af9068c03970d4d63d24d6883b36aa696423f5ed92b:3

value
140440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873f1ae9b3fe455a7d4e446fb6998680fd0ec11d OP_EQUAL
address
3E28k4Z1vegmMRSYyP15NXguDvJJwrfgyU
transaction
437856677d723fbb7eb82af9068c03970d4d63d24d6883b36aa696423f5ed92b
confirmations
488358
spent
true